How to Start a Sportsbook

A sportsbook is a gambling establishment that accepts wagers on various sporting events. It can be a standalone business or part of a larger casino/gaming network. It is common for a sportsbook to offer other gambling services such as a racebook, online casino and live casino. Some sportsbooks also feature a full-service horse racing service and a wide variety of video poker, table games, slots, and bingo.

In the United States, a sportsbook is regulated by the Federal Trade Commission (FTC), Department of Justice (DOJ) and state governments. It is essential to understand the legal landscape and consult with a qualified lawyer to ensure your sportsbook meets all necessary requirements.

To start your own sportsbook, you will need sufficient capital. This will be determined by your target market, licensing costs and monetary guarantees required by the government. In addition, you will need a computer system to manage your data.

Before you can launch your sportsbook, you will need to determine what your budget is and how big or small you want your sportsbook to be. Then, you will need to research the industry and decide what services you will offer. For instance, you might choose to only offer a few sports at first and then expand later. You will also need to figure out what kind of software you need, payment options and which sports you want to cover.

Most sportsbooks use American odds to show how much you could win on a $100 bet. These are calculated using the probability of an event occurring. However, the odds aren’t necessarily accurate and can be misleading. For example, a team with odds of +400 will win more frequently than one with odds of -400.

When choosing a sportsbook, it’s important to find a company that has an experienced management team. This will help you run your sportsbook more effectively and increase your profits. You should also be sure that your sportsbook is licensed by a reputable regulatory body.

It’s also important to include a good UX and design in your sportsbook. Otherwise, your users will quickly get frustrated and leave. Also, make sure that you have enough betting markets. If you have too few, your users will only be able to place a limited number of bets and may lose money. Lastly, you should include a multi-layer validation system. This will prevent players from making bets that are not legitimate. This will save you a lot of money in the long run and will keep your customers happy.